100Gb/s QSFP28 BiDi ER 40km DDM Transceiver

 

PRODUCT FEATURES

  • QSFP28 MSA package with simplex LC connector
  • Compliant to 100G Lamda MSA 100G-ER1 Optical Specifications
  • Lane signaling rate 53.125GBd with PAM4
  • High speed I/O electrical interface
  • Two Wire Serial Interface with Digital Diagnostic Monitoring
  • Operating case temperature range 0°C to +70°C
  • Support KP4 FEC inside the module and KP4 FEC shutdown
  • Reaches up to 40km on SMF
  • Maximum power consumption 4.5W
  • 3.3V power supply voltage
  • compliant to RoHS2.0
  • Class 1 Laser

APPLICATIONS

  • 100 Gigabit Ethernet
  • Data Center

Notes:

  • As the total average launch power limit has to be met, not all of the lanes can operate at the maximum average launch power, each lane.
  • Average launch power, each lane(min) is informative and not the principal indicator of signal strength. A transmitter with launch power below this value can not be compliant: however, a value above this does not ensure compliance.
  • Transmitter reflectance is defined looking into the transmitter.
  • The receiver shall be able to tolerate, without damage, continuous exposure to an optical input signal having this average power level.
  • Average receiver power, each lane(min) is informative and not the principal indicator of signal strength. A received power below this value cannot be compliant; however, a value above this does not ensure compliance.
  • Measured with conformance test signal at TP3 for the BER specified in <100G-FR and 100G-LR1 Technical Specifications Rev 2.0>.
  • These test conditions are for measuring stressed receiver sensitivity. They are not characteristics of the receiver.
